What is the first step a clinician takes when placing a medication order in the Epic system?

The first step a clinician takes when placing a medication order in the Epic system is to enter the medication order directly into the system. This action is essential as it initiates the medication management process, allowing for proper documentation and tracking of patient medication orders. By placing the order, the clinician communicates their intent to administer a specific medication, which then allows for subsequent actions like pharmacy review, nursing documentation, and administration of the medication to the patient.

This initial step is crucial for ensuring that the medication is accurately recorded and that all relevant parties, including pharmacy and nursing staff, are informed of the order, enabling a seamless workflow for medication administration.
